Barhara
Barhara is a village located in Rudrapur tehsil of Deoria district in Uttar Pradesh, India. Deoria and Rudrapur are the district & sub-district headquarters of Barhara village respectively. As per 2009 stats, Harahi Nadolava is the gram panchayat of Barhara village.

About Barhara
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Barhara is 190724. The village spans a total geographical area of 194.599 hectares. Deoria is nearest town to Barhara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 1km away.

Population of Barhara
Below is a concise population overview of Barhara as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,050 | 504 | 546 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 152 | 76 | 76 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 109 | 43 | 66 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 644 | 365 | 279 |
Illiterate Population | 406 | 139 | 267 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Barhara village:
- The total population of Barhara village is around 1,050, including approximately 504 males and 546 females, with a sex ratio of 1083 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 152 children aged 0–6 years in Barhara village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Barhara village has 109 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Barhara village is about 61.33%, with male literacy at 72.42% and female literacy at 51.10%.
- There are around 188 households in Barhara village.
Connectivity of Barhara
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Barhara. As per the 2011 stats, Barhara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
